随着智能手机的普及,越来越多的应用需要连接数据库。而MySQL数据库是一种流行的关系型数据库,本文将介绍如何在手机端连接MySQL数据库。
首先,需要在服务器端打开对外的数据库连接口,即把MySQL的端口从默认的3306改为可以在外网访问的端口。这可以通过修改my.cnf配置文件来实现。例如:
[mysqld]
port=3307
bind-address=0.0.0.0
接下来,在手机应用中使用JDBC连接MySQL数据库。需要先下载mysql-connector-java.jar包,并在代码中添加:
Class.forName("com.mysql.jdbc.Driver");
Connection conn = DriverManager.getConnection("jdbc:mysql://112.33.45.67:3307/testing?useUnicode=true&characterEncoding=UTF-8", "user", "password");
其中,“112.33.45.67”是服务器的公网IP地址,“testing”是要连接的数据库名,“user”和“password”是数据库的用户名和密码。
在使用完连接后需要手动关闭数据库连接,以免造成资源浪费。代码如下:
conn.close();
总结来说,连接MySQL数据库需要在服务器端开放端口,下载mysql-connector-java.jar包,使用JDBC连接数据库,最后手动关闭连接。这些步骤一旦掌握,就可以在手机应用中轻松地连接MySQL数据库。